Wood panels which have been There is the Cut Direct, the most brutal of the Four Cardinal Cuts or so I call them which is to stare someone in the face and pretend not to know them, and then there is the Cut Indirect, which is to look away and pretend not to have seen. During the Regency, members of the ton would be expected to fast and then take communion after the ceremony, so the meal served after the ceremony would have broken their fasting.
